Whatโs New in v1.2
๐ Living Districts
Districts now track more than static Hype and Trust. They also react to what is happening in real time, including player presence, recent momentum, live category pressure, and notable influence within the area.
๐ฅ Active Player Presence
CityPulse now tracks which districts players are physically gathering in. Districts can recognize when people are building a scene, moving crowds, or clustering into hotspots.
โญ Player Influence Scoring
Not every player presence is treated the same anymore. Fame, Heat, and live activity now help determine how strongly a player influences the feel of a district. A well-known creator, rising figure, or high-heat presence can now affect district behavior far more than random foot traffic.
๐ต๐ฏ Activity-Based District Identity
Live activity and recent behavior now help shape what a district is currently known for. Music, cars, nightlife, business, sports, and community activity can all help drive a districtโs live category.
๐ District Momentum
Districts now remember what has been happening recently. Live activity and completed events contribute to short-term momentum, helping areas feel like they are building, surging, stabilizing, or becoming volatile.
๐ง Smarter District Mood Logic
District moods are now far more dynamic. Instead of only feeling flat or generic, districts can now read as:
- Quiet
- Calm
- Building
- Buzzing
- Surging
- Trusted
- Steady
- Hotspot
- Celebrated
- Volatile
- Unsafe
This gives CityPulse a much better sense of the cityโs social atmosphere.
๐ฐ Automated District Feed Updates
CityPulse can now automatically generate district-related feed posts when something important is happening. That means the app can report on rising hotspots, growing crowds, trusted scenes, unstable areas, and district momentum without relying only on manual player-created posts.
๐ Districts Page Overhaul
The Districts tab now has a much stronger read on each area, including improved status summaries, player counts, energy, risk, momentum, mood, spotlight influence, and category pressure. District data should now feel far more useful and immersive.
